Kim Cattrall Just Got Real About Her Sex And The City Costars

Few squads have resonated with this generation like the fabulous ladies of Sex and the City. Carrie Bradshaw, Samantha Jones, Charlotte York and Miranda Hobbes represented every It girl’s ideal group of friends, with their signature styles and witty banter among the qualities we envied most. However, it turns out our favorite gal pals may not have been soul mates at all offscreen. In a recent interview with Piers Morgan for ITV series Life Stories, Kim Cattrall shockingly revealed she and her SATC costars have—hold your breath—”never been friends.” (BRB, we need a cosmo to write the rest of this.)

“We’ve been colleagues, and in some ways it’s a very healthy place to be,” she explained.

Since news of the third movie’s cancellation made headlines, rumors have circulated that the actress, who played the unapologetically outspoken Samantha in the series, made demands that led to its demise. In fact, the real-life drama among the cast seems to have reached an all-time high, especially after Kim recently said that Sarah Jessica Parker “could’ve been nicer” in expressing her disappointment.
